Founders Circle Capital has raised a new $355 million fund to buy secondary startup shares (TechCrunch)

Connie Loizos

Founders Circle Capital, a nine-year-old, San Francisco-based investment firm that strikes agreements with private, venture-backed companies to buy some of the vested stock options of their founders and employees — so they can buy a house or just breathe a bit more easily — has closed its newest fund with $355 million in capital commitments, bringing the firm’s total assets under management to nearly $1 billion.
